Falls to 1-4 in past five fights
BantamweightUFC
February 7, 2026
Cachoeira lost to Klaudia Sygula via unanimous decision (27-30, 27-30, 28-29) at UFC Fight Night on Saturday in Las Vegas.
ANALYSIS
This was Cachoeira's 13th UFC fight and also the 13th time in which she entered as the betting underdog. This time, at +155. Inside the Octagon, it was the same old story for the Brazilian. Cachoeira is super aggressive on the feet and displays some of the worst stand-up defense in the sport. She has no interest in moving her head off the center line, instead opting to eat all the damage coming her way. As a result, even an opponent with limited power like Sygula can have a career night offensively. Maybe Cachoeira has a little extra wiggle room because she trains with Amanda Nunes, but now sporting a 1-4 record in her past five fights, her roster spot has to be in jeopardy.
Stopped early in Vegas
BantamweightUFC
August 10, 2025
Cachoeira lost to Joselyne Edwards via KO (punches) at 2:24 of Round 1 at UFC Vegas 109 on Saturday.
ANALYSIS
Cachoeira was somewhat effective with her striking early on, which included an eye poke, but the longer, stronger Edwards didn't take long to find her mark. Cachoeira ate a clean 1-2 that had her out on her feet, as well as a few follow-up shots, before referee Herb Dean could jump in. Any momentum Cachoeira picked up with her victory over Josiane Nunes in March has now halted, and she's now lost three of her last four.

Snaps brief losing streak
BantamweightUFC
March 15, 2025
Cachoeira defeated Josiane Nunes via KO (punch) at 2:46 of Round 1 at UFC Fight Night on Saturday in Las Vegas.
ANALYSIS
Both women entered having lost each of their past two bouts, and the one that came up short here would almost certainly be looking at a release. Cachoeira responded with a trademark performance, aided by some recklessness on the Nunes side. Now 36 years old, Priscila brings little to the table other than her power. Thus, leave it to Nunes to push forward without a care in the world and get cracked with a fight-ending uppercut. It would go on to earn Cachoeira one of four $50,000 Performance of the Night bonuses awarded on the evening. Little should be expected of Cachoeira moving forward, although her roster spot should be secure for one more fight after this win.
